The mbihs is a 22item selfreport questionnaire that consists of three independently scored dimensions emotional exhaustion, depersonalization and a lack of personal accomplishment. The maslach burnout inventory mbi is an introspective psychological inventory consisting of 22 items pertaining to occupational burnout. In nearly all countries the two items 6 and 16 related to the stress and strain involved in working with people loaded on the depersonalization subscale rather than the emotional exhaustion subscale to which they were initially assigned. The 22 total items are broken up into the three themes with nine items relating to emotional exhaustion, five to depersonalization, and eight to accomplishment as shown in table 1.
